manual locking hubs
 
is it possible to put manual locking hubs on the 2nd gen daks? i got a 2002 qc 4.7 awd. does anybody even make manual hubs for these trucks? i figure if you could unlock the hubs and keep the front drivetrain from, you could save a couple mpg's and decrease the wear on the front end. will it do anything for the AWD? thanks

Crazy4x4RT 04-22-2011 12:11 AM

No you can not. By factory it should have a CAD (Central Axle Disconnect) which does the same thing, it disconnects 1 axle shaft so the entire axle doesn't move.
